Add ImageNext Generation Sequencing (NGS) has revolutionized biology and is in the process of revolutionizing medicine. The prices are dropping much faster than even predicted by Moore’s law. It is possible now to sequence the human genome for $5,000 and the prices are dropping. For $5,000 you get a file that contains hundreds of millions of short sequences amounting to ~90,000,000,000 letters A, T, G, C that correspond to a DNA sequence from some place in the human genome. One of these letters might be different from what one normally has and that one difference can be responsible for cancer. Or be completely harmless.

The future is sequence-based and completely digital – DNA from every blood test, every biopsy, every nose swab will be sequenced. It is clear that the problem is no going to be how to get the data – that part is quickly becoming a commodity with razor-thin margins – but what to do with these data, how to extract actionable knowledge from this overwhelming flood.

Scale Genomics provides the Cloud NGS Platform for carrying out the information extraction from the NGS data. We have built a software layer (called Open Scale) that allows researchers or companies to store and share their data, and to build and share analyses pipelines with the maximum levels of flexibility, transparency and control. Everything is done on top of Linux and open source virtual machine tools. The plan is to make Open Scale available for installation on client machines with a seamless integration into the Scale Genomics Cloud.

We provide data storage at a fraction of the cost of Amazon and specialize in the creation of high-end virtual machines that are applicable for high-powered computation needed in the NGS field. Our service is agnostic about which cloud we run our software layer on and in expect to run it on multiple clouds. For now, the cloud computing prices are too high and we run a private cloud.

Ultimately we also aim to provide:

  • an App Store for NGS analysis software,
  • a services marketplace that connects bioinformaticians with biologists and medical professionals,
  • a high-end bioinformatics consulting service,
  • and a back-end white label platform that can be used by biotech and medical services companies to hang their shingle on and to seamlessly provide their services.
